Step 1: Preheat the Oven and Prepare the Pans
First things first, you're going to want to preheat your oven to 350°F (about 175°C). This ensures that when you're ready to bake, the oven is perfectly heated, setting you up for success. While that’s happening, grab two loaf pans (typically 9x5 inches) and either line them with parchment paper or grease them well. A good non-stick spray or a light coating of oil will do the trick, preventing your pumpkin bread from sticking to the pan.
Step 2: Mix the Wet Ingredients Together
In a large mixing bowl, combine your sugars—both the white and light brown—along with the vegetable oil, beaten eggs, and the pureed pumpkin. Don't rush; give everything a good stir until it’s well mixed. The pumpkin puree is what gives this bread its moist texture and delicious flavor, so make sure it’s blended seamlessly! Add in the water, stirring just enough to combine. This mix is what makes our copycat Starbucks pumpkin bread so rich and flavorful.
Step 3: Whisk the Dry Ingredients Separately
Now, let’s move on to the dry ingredients. In another bowl, sift or whisk together the flour, baking soda, salt, ground cloves, pumpkin pie spice, and nutmeg. Sifting these ingredients helps them to incorporate evenly, which is critical for achieving the perfect texture in your bread. The warm spices bring that signature autumn warmth to each slice.
Step 4: Combine the Mixtures Carefully
Pour your wet mixture into the bowl with the dry ingredients. Now, here’s where it’s important—you want to mix these together just enough to combine. Overmixing can lead to a denser bread, and we’re aiming for that delightful fluffy loaf experience! Use a spatula or wooden spoon, and just gently fold the ingredients until you see no more dry flour.
Step 5: Pour into Loaf Pans and Add Toppings
Once everything is beautifully blended, divide the batter evenly into your prepared loaf pans. At this point, if you’re feeling adventurous, sprinkle some chopped Pepitas (green pumpkin seeds) on top! This will not only enhance the flavor but also add a wonderful crunch that complements the soft bread.
Step 6: Bake to Perfection
Now it’s time to bake! Place your loaf pans in the preheated oven, and let them bake for about 1 hour. You'll know it's done when a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. When the aroma of pumpkin spice fills your kitchen, you’ll find it hard to wait! Once baked, remove the loaves from the oven and allow them to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Gluten-Free Pumpkin Bread Alternative
Don’t let gluten hold you back from enjoying copycat Starbucks pumpkin bread! For a gluten-free version, simply substitute regular flour with a 1:1 gluten-free baking blend. Many options contain a mix of rice flour, almond flour, and tapioca starch, ensuring you won’t miss the gluten. Add a bit of xanthan gum to help bind the ingredients together if your blend doesn't include it. You’ll be amazed at how delicious and moist the bread remains!

Avoiding Overmixing for a Fluffy Texture
When making your copycat Starbucks pumpkin bread, remember that less is more when it comes to mixing. Overmixing can lead to a dense loaf instead of the fluffy texture you crave. Once you've combined the wet and dry ingredients, mix just until you no longer see dry flour. It's okay if the batter looks a bit lumpy; this will yield a tender bread with the perfect crumb.
Tips for Testing Doneness
Determining when your copycat Starbucks pumpkin bread is ready can be tricky, but it's essential for that perfect bake. Insert a toothpick in the center—if it comes out clean or with just a few crumbs clinging to it, your bread is done! To avoid the common pitfall of underbaking, double-check around the 55-minute mark. If the top looks golden brown, but the toothpick isn't clean yet, cover it loosely with foil to prevent over-browning while it bakes a little longer. Happy baking! FAQ about Copycat Starbucks Pumpkin Bread
Can I freeze pumpkin bread?
Absolutely! Freezing copycat Starbucks pumpkin bread is a great way to enjoy it later. To freeze, wrap each loaf tightly in plastic wrap and then place it in a freezer-safe bag. It can be stored for up to three months. Just remember to let it thaw in the fridge overnight when you're ready to indulge!
How should I store homemade pumpkin bread?
To keep your copycat Starbucks pumpkin bread fresh, store it in an airtight container at room temperature. Make sure it's completely cooled before sealing. It should last about 3-5 days. If you're not finishing it within that time, consider freezing a loaf for later.
What can I use instead of pumpkin pie spice?
If you find yourself out of pumpkin pie spice, don’t worry! You can easily make your own by mixing equal parts of cinnamon, nutmeg, and ginger. Feel free to add a pinch of allspice or cloves for a deeper flavor. This substitute gives your copycat Starbucks pumpkin bread that warm, spiced profile that makes it so irresistible.

Copycat Starbucks Pumpkin Bread: Easy Homemade Indulgence
Equipment
- oven
- Mixing Bowls
- Loaf Pans
- Whisk
- sifter
Ingredients
Sugars
- 2 cups white sugar
- 1 cup light brown sugar
Wet Ingredients
- 1 cup vegetable oil
- 4 eggs, beaten
- 1 15 oz pure pureed pumpkin
- ⅔ cup water
Dry Ingredients
- 3 ½ cups flour
- 2 teaspoons baking soda
- 1 ½ teaspoons salt
- 2 teaspoons ground cloves
- 1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ice
- ½ te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 2-4 tablespoons Pepitas (green pumpkin seeds), chopped
Instructions
Baking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350F.
- In a large bowl combine both sugars, oil, eggs and pureed pumpkin.
- Stir together well.
- Add water and stir well.
- In another bowl sift or whisk together, flour, baking soda, salt, ground cloves, pumpkin pie spice and ground nutmeg.
- Pour wet mixture into flour mixture and stir together. Stir just enough to mix everything together but don't over mix.
- Pour batter evenly into 2 loaf pans that have either been lined with parchment paper or greased well.
- Sprinkle chopped Pepitas (green pumpkin seeds) over the top of batter.
- Bake for 1 hour.
- Remove from oven and let cool.
